Requirements

  • 3+ years of experience in a financial analysis, data analyst, or FP&A role
  • Comfortable working with financial software platforms (experience with Sage X3 and/or NetSuite a strong plus)
  • Functional familiarity with SQL—able to write simple queries to extract and interpret data
  • Ability to detect anomalies or inconsistencies in data
  • Ability to translate financial insights for non-financial audiences
  • Experience with tools (Big Query, Looker, Excel/Google Sheets)
  • Experience supporting cross-functional financial initiatives with RevOps, AP, or AR teams
  • Exposure to BI tools such as Looker, Tableau, Power BI, or similar

Responsibilities

  • Create and analyse recurring (BAU) reports around client billing, revenue performance, and profitability
  • Collaborate on data collection, governance, and analysis of monthly recognition and forecasting cycles
  • Maintain analysis to support Finance and RevOps teams with up-to-date, accurate metrics
  • Act as a partner to Finance and RevOps to agree on revenue recognition, billing accuracy, and client-level profitability
  • Participate in finance system transition efforts (e.g., Sage X3 to NetSuite) by supporting data migration, validation, and process adaptation
  • Conduct exploratory and on-demand financial analysis to support projects, business cases, and performance reviews from department leads and senior leadership
  • Identify trends, outliers, or risks within financial datasets and raise them for consideration
  • Extract, clean, and prepare data from financial systems and standard SQL-based tables
  • Ensure data integrity across spreadsheets, internal platforms, and financial software
  • Propose process improvements in financial data handling, reporting automation, or analysis frameworks

About Jellyfish

Jellyfish offers a platform that integrates business and financial strategies into the Software Development Life Cycle (SDLC). It provides insights into engineering efforts, helping businesses improve planning and decision-making while identifying bottlenecks to enhance operational efficiency. The platform also tracks deliverable progress and focuses on team health by combining quantitative data with qualitative feedback. Jellyfish aims to improve the effectiveness of engineering teams, ensuring they can deliver value efficiently.
